Output 80659c2e85b8982eff9444f08ba572a5d172fca3ccd97a54cceadb6d49d87cd5:0

value
4266476
script pubkey
OP_0 OP_PUSHBYTES_20 b966af303709f885d165cfb11678b3139eaf4431
address
bc1qh9n27vphp8ugt5t9e7c3v79nzw0273p3470t8g
transaction
80659c2e85b8982eff9444f08ba572a5d172fca3ccd97a54cceadb6d49d87cd5
confirmations
202676
spent
true